Low pressure often traces to a worn impeller or damaged drop cable. Voltage drop at the control box points to corroded splices. Roto Master Pump Service pulls the pump only after confirming the issue with a clamp meter.

The team replaces the cable with 10-gauge submersible wire rated for direct burial. Roto Master Pump Service resets the pressure switch cut-in to 30 psi and cut-out to 50 psi.

How long do sump pumps last?
Sump pumps typically last 7 to 10 years with regular use. Roto Master Pump Service in Brazil, IN recommends annual checks to extend service life. Call (833) 599-4825 for an inspection.

Pedestal versus submersible sump pump?
Pedestal models sit above the water with the motor exposed while submersible units operate fully underwater. Roto Master Pump Service installs both types in Brazil, IN. Phone (833) 599-4825 for guidance.
How deep should a sump pit be?
A standard sump pit measures 18 to 24 inches deep and 18 inches wide for proper drainage. Roto Master Pump Service builds pits to code in Brazil, IN. Contact (833) 599-4825 for installation.
